You are transporting logs. The driving route means you have to drive along poor quality roads. What do you have to do?

Choose one or multiple correct answers

I have to

  • A. - regularly check that the load is secure
  • B. - adapt my speed to the carriageway and the load
  • C. - ensure that the frictional forces between the logs are reduced to the minimum possible level

Correct answer

  • A. - regularly check that the load is secure
  • B. - adapt my speed to the carriageway and the load
